Two immutable sorted collections are available: ImmutableSortedDictionary
and ImmutableSortedSet<>
. Below is an example illustrating how to construct an immutable sorted collection using a builder.
var builder = ImmutableSortedSet.CreateBuilder<Person>();
foreach (var person in people)
{
_ = builder.Add(person);
}
var collection = builder.ToImmutable();
You also have the option to utilize CreateRange()
.
var collection = ImmutableSortedDictionary.CreateRange(personDictionary);
Benchmark Results
Here are the performance results. As evident, the ImmutableSortedDictionary<,>
consistently shows lower performance compared to the ImmutableSortedSet<>
in both scenarios. Furthermore, using CreateRange()
proves to be more performant than employing CreateBuilder()
with foreach()
.
I’d like to emphasize that employing a regular List<>
with the Sort()
method tends to be more efficient than opting for an immutable sorted collection.
